
Accessibility Specialist (Tester)
Job Title: Accessibility Specialist (Tester)
Location: Newark, NJ, USA (Onsite 1 or 2 day per week)
Duration: 12 months+ or full time
Industry: Health Insurance, IT Services, Web & Mobile Applications
Job Summary:
The Onsite Accessibility Specialist will be responsible for ensuring digital accessibility compliance across web and mobile applications. This role requires working closely with cross-functional teams, including designers, developers, and business stakeholders, to integrate accessibility best practices throughout the software development lifecycle. The specialist will conduct audits, provide remediation guidance, and help ensure compliance with WCAG 2.1 AA(Web Content Accessibility 2. 1 AA Guidelines).
Key Responsibilities:
1. Accessibility Compliance & Audits
- Conduct accessibility audits and assessments for websites, mobile applications, and digital platforms.
- Identify and document accessibility barriers and provide remediation recommendations.
- Ensure compliance with WCAG 2.1 regulations.
2. Collaboration & Stakeholder Engagement
- Work onsite with UX designers, developers, business analysts, and project managers to incorporate accessibility from the design phase.
- Provide hands-on guidance to teams for fixing accessibility issues in real-time.
- Conduct training sessions and workshops for internal teams on accessibility standards and best practices.
3. Testing & Remediation
- Perform manual and automated accessibility testing using tools like Axe, JAWS, NVDA, VoiceOver etc.
- Collaborate with development teams to troubleshoot and remediate accessibility issues.
- Validate accessibility fixes before deployment.
4. Documentation & Compliance Reporting
- Develop accessibility compliance reports, VPATs, and audit findings.
- Maintain detailed documentation of accessibility evaluations and remediation steps.
- Keep up to date with evolving accessibility laws, guidelines, and industry trends.
Required Skills & Qualifications:
Technical Skills:
- Expertise in WCAG 2.1 standards.
- Strong knowledge of H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and accessibility-related development practices.
- Hands-on experience with screen readers and assistive technologies (JAWS, NVDA, VoiceOver, TalkBack).
- Familiarity with accessibility testing tools (Axe, WAVE, Lighthouse, Tenon).
- Understanding of document accessibility (PDF, Word, Excel) using tools like Adobe Acrobat and Microsoft Office.
